Jewish tunes could be the audio and melodies on the Jewish folks. There exist the two traditions of religious new music, as sung within the synagogue and domestic prayers, and of secular tunes, for example klezmer. While some components of Jewish music may well originate in biblical periods (Biblical audio), variations of rhythm and seem are available amid later Jewish communities that were musically motivated by place.

Zemirot are hymns, typically sung in the Hebrew or Aramaic languages, but often also in Yiddish or Ladino. The phrases to lots of zemirot are taken from poems composed by various rabbis and sages for the duration of the Middle Ages. Some others are anonymous people music.

Jewish liturgical songs is characterised by a set of musical modes. These modes make up musical nusach, which serves to equally identify different types of prayer, and also to hyperlink All those prayers to time of year, as well as time of working day by which These are set. You'll find a few main modes, as well as a amount of combined or compound modes. The 3 major modes are called Ahavah Rabbah, Magein Avot and Adonai Malach. Typically, the cantor (chazzan) improvised sung prayers in the selected mode, although pursuing a general construction of how Every single prayer should really sound.

The 1930s saw an influx of Jewish composers to British Obligatory Palestine, later Israel, amongst them musicians of stature in Europe. These composers involved Paul Ben-Haim, Erich Walter Sternberg, Marc Lavry, Ödön Pártos, and Alexander Uriah Boskovich. These composers were all concerned with forging a different Jewish id in songs, an identification which might accommodate the new, emerging here identification of Israel. When the reaction of each of these composers to this problem was intensely particular, there was one distinct pattern to which lots of them adhered: lots of of these along with other composers sought to distance by themselves within the musical style of the Klezmer, which they viewed as weak and unsuitable for the new nationwide ethos.}
